How to fill out grant in aid

How to fill out grant in aid:
01
Start by gathering all necessary documents and information. This may include proof of income, tax returns, bank statements, and any other required paperwork.
02
Research and identify the specific grant in aid program or organization you are applying to. Understand their eligibility criteria, application deadlines, and any specific requirements they may have.
03
Carefully read and follow the instructions provided in the grant in aid application form. Make sure to provide accurate and complete information to avoid any delays or rejections.
04
Write a compelling and detailed statement of need. Clearly explain why you require financial assistance and how the grant in aid would help you achieve your goals or overcome your challenges.
05
Provide supporting documentation or evidence to strengthen your application. This may include recommendation letters, academic transcripts, or medical reports, depending on the nature of the grant in aid.
06
Review your completed application thoroughly for any errors or omissions. Double-check all the information you have provided to ensure its accuracy.
07
Submit your grant in aid application before the specified deadline. Keep copies of all submitted documents for your records.
Who needs grant in aid:
01
Individuals or families facing financial hardships who are unable to afford the costs of education, healthcare, housing, or basic necessities may require grant in aid.
02
Non-profit organizations or community groups seeking funding for projects or initiatives that benefit a specific cause or address societal issues may also need grant in aid.
03
Students pursuing higher education and unable to cover the expenses of tuition, books, or living costs may rely on grant in aid to support their academic journey.
04
Medical patients or individuals with disabilities who require specialized treatments, equipment, or care may seek grant in aid to alleviate their financial burden.
05
Entrepreneurs or small business owners who need financial assistance to start or grow their ventures may apply for grant in aid programs that support business development.
